[0001] This application relates to the field of battery production equipment technology, and in particular to a coating mechanism and coating device. Background Technology
[0002] During the production of pouch batteries, a wrapping film or easy-tear sticker needs to be applied to the surface of the cells to facilitate disassembly and repair of the finished batteries after they are installed in the battery compartment. During the film application process, the wrapping film is first pasted onto the larger side (front) of the cell in the thickness direction. Then, the portion of the wrapping film extending beyond the front side needs to be rolled from the side seal of the cell onto the larger side (back) of the cell.
[0003] Current coating equipment typically uses a single roller to roll the coating film from the side seal of the battery cell to the back of the battery cell. However, due to processing limitations, the side seal of the battery cell cannot be made entirely flat. Its central area is flat, while the two ends along its length are curved surfaces. In addition, in order to avoid the FPC circuitry of the battery cell, the coating film also has notches. This causes the coating film to wrinkle and accumulate at the notches during the process of rolling the coating film from the side seal of the battery cell to the back of the battery cell using a single roller, resulting in a poor appearance of the product after coating. Utility Model Content
[0004] The purpose of this invention is to provide a coating mechanism and coating device to prevent the coating film from accumulating and wrinkling at the gap when the coating film is applied to the side of the battery cell.

[0043] The following reference Figures 1 to 3 This application describes a coating mechanism and coating device according to some embodiments.
[0044] This application provides a coating mechanism for rolling a portion of the coating film extending from the front of the battery cell along the side seal of the battery cell to the back of the battery cell.
[0045] like Figure 3 As shown, the coating mechanism includes a rolling assembly 1, which includes a first roller 11 and a second roller 12. For a battery cell with a coating film attached to its front side, the first roller 11 is used to roll the coating film extending from the front of the battery cell onto the side seal of the battery cell. After the first roller 11 completes the application of the coating film to the side seal, a portion of the coating film extends out of the side seal, and then the second roller 12 is used to roll the portion of the coating film extending out of the side seal onto the back of the battery cell.
[0046] The central area of the side seal is a planar area. The length of the first roller 11 is adapted to the planar area of the side seal. When applying the wrapping film to the side seal of the battery cell, the first roller 11 can roll over the planar area of the side seal, and the notch in the wrapping film is located on the planar area. The length of the second roller 12 is greater than the length of the first roller 11, and the length of the second roller 12 can cover the wrapping film. That is, the dimension of the wrapping film in the length direction of the second roller 12 is smaller than the length dimension of the second roller 12 and falls completely within the length coverage area of the second roller 12.
[0047] Therefore, this application sets two rollers of different lengths. First, the shorter first roller 11 is used to roll the wrapping film onto the side seal of the battery cell, and the first roller 11 only covers the flat area in the middle of the side seal, leaving the uneven areas at both ends of the side seal unwrapped. Then, the longer second roller 12 is used to roll the wrapping film onto the back of the battery cell. This can effectively prevent the wrapping film from accumulating and wrinkling at its gaps, ensuring that the appearance of the battery cell after wrapping film is applied meets the requirements.
[0048] In one embodiment of this application, preferably, as shown below, Figure 3 As shown, the rolling assembly 1 includes a fixed base 13. The two ends of the first roller 11 and the two ends of the second roller 12 are respectively mounted on the fixed base 13 through supports, so that both the first roller 11 and the second roller 12 can rotate around their own axes. The axis of the first roller 11 is set along the first direction a, and one side of the first roller 11 in the second direction b is used to face the side seal of the battery cell. The first roller 11 can roll over the side seal along the third direction c to roll the part of the wrapping film extending from the front of the battery cell onto the side seal. The first direction a, the second direction b and the third direction c are perpendicular to each other. The third direction c is the thickness direction of the battery cell and also the width direction of the side seal. The first direction a is parallel to the length direction of the side seal, and the second direction b is perpendicular to the side seal.
[0049] The axis of the second roller 12 is also set along the first direction a. The first roller 11 and the second roller 12 are arranged side by side and spaced apart along the second direction b. The second roller 12 is located on the side of the first roller 11 away from the side seal, so that when the first roller 11 rolls over the side seal, the second roller 12 does not contact the side seal.
[0050] The second roller 12 can move relative to the battery cell along the second direction b and roll on the back of the battery cell along the second direction b to push the portion of the wrapping film extending from the side seal to fold toward the back of the battery cell and roll it onto the back of the battery cell. In this embodiment, the first roller 11 and the second roller 12 are offset in the third direction c, so that when the second roller 12 rolls on the back of the battery cell, the first roller 11 is spaced a predetermined distance from the back of the battery cell to avoid the first roller 11 contacting the back of the battery cell. At the same time, when the second roller 12 rolls the wrapping film onto the back of the battery cell, the first roller 11 can play a pre-guiding role for the wrapping film.
[0051] In this embodiment, preferably, the misalignment distance between the first roller 11 and the second roller 12 in the third direction c is 3mm to 8mm.
[0052] In one embodiment of this application, preferably, as shown below, Figure 3As shown, the rolling assembly includes a first bracket 15 and a first elastic member 14. The fixed seat 13 is movably mounted on the first bracket 15 along a third direction c. The two ends of the first elastic member 14 abut against the fixed seat 13 and the first bracket 15, respectively. When the second roller 12 abuts against the back of the battery cell, the first elastic member 14 can increase the elastic force of the fixed seat 13 along the third direction c, so that the fixed seat 13 has a tendency to move towards the back of the battery cell, thereby making the second roller 12 elastically abut against the back of the battery cell, so that the second roller 12 can roll stably on the back of the battery cell to roll the wrapping film onto the back of the battery cell.
[0053] In one embodiment of this application, preferably, as shown below, Figure 3 As shown, the rolling assembly also includes a second bracket 16 and a first driving member 17. The second bracket 16 is fixedly mounted, and the first driving member 17 is fixed to the second bracket 16. The driving end of the first driving member 17 is connected to the first bracket 15, and the driving end of the first driving member 17 is extendable along the second direction b, so that the rolling assembly 1 on the first bracket 15 can move along the second direction b under the drive of the first driving member 17. Therefore, when rolling the side seal of the battery cell, the first driving member 17 can be used to adjust the relative position between the first roller 11 and the side seal in the second direction b, so that when the first roller 11 and the battery cell move relative to each other in the third direction c, the first roller 11 can roll over the side seal. At the same time, when rolling the wrapping film onto the back of the battery cell, the first driving member 17 can drive the second roller 12 to move along the second direction b.
[0054] In this embodiment, preferably, as follows: Figure 3 As shown, the driving end of the first driving member 17 is provided with a connecting shaft, which is connected to a first limiting part and a second limiting part that are spaced apart along the second direction b. The first bracket 15 is provided with a snap-fit part, which is snapped between the first limiting part and the second limiting part, so that the first bracket 15 can move along the second direction b under the drive of the first driving member 17, and the first bracket 15 can also move relative to the connecting shaft between the first limiting part and the second limiting part along the second direction b.
[0055] Furthermore, the rolling assembly also includes a second elastic member 18, which is disposed along the second direction b. One end of the second elastic member 18 abuts against the first support 15, and the other end of the second elastic member 18 abuts against the second support 16. The second elastic member 18 can provide the first support 15 with an elastic force along the second direction b, so that the second support 16 has a tendency to move in the direction of the battery cell along the second direction b.
[0056] When using the first roller 11 to roll and wrap the side seal of the battery cell, the position between the first roller 11 and the side seal can be adjusted first using the first drive member 17. When the first roller 11 abuts against the side seal, the cooperation between the first bracket 15 and the connecting shaft and the elastic force of the second elastic member 18 make the abutment between the first roller 11 and the side seal elastic, thereby ensuring that the first roller 11 rolls stably over the side seal.
[0057] In one embodiment of this application, preferably, as shown below,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, the wrapping mechanism also includes a lifting assembly and a suction plate 4 assembly.
[0058] The lifting assembly includes a platform 2 and a second driving member 3. The platform 2 is used to support the back of the battery cell. The driving end of the second driving member 3 is connected to the platform 2 to drive the platform 2 and the battery cell on the platform 2 to move along a third direction c.
[0059] The suction plate 4 assembly includes a suction plate 4 and a third driving member 5. The suction plate 4 is used to adsorb the front side of the battery cell. The suction plate 4 and the stage 2 are arranged opposite each other along the third direction c. The suction plate 4 is connected to the driving end of the third driving member 5, so that the suction plate 4 can move along the third direction c under the drive of the third driving member 5.
[0060] When applying the wrapping film to the side seal of the battery cell, the battery cell with the wrapping film on its front is first placed on the platform 2, with the back of the battery cell facing the platform 2. Then, the suction plate 4 moves towards the platform 2 until it abuts against the front of the battery cell, and the suction plate 4 is used to adhere to the front of the battery cell. Then, the platform 2 and the suction plate 4 simultaneously move the battery cell along a third direction c, causing the battery cell and the first roller 11 to move relative to each other along the third direction c, and the first roller 11 rolls over the side seal of the battery cell to complete the rolling application of the wrapping film to the side seal of the battery cell. By using the platform 2 and the suction plate 4 to hold the battery cell and move it, misalignment of the battery cell and the wrapping film during the application of the wrapping film can be avoided.
[0061] After the side sealing film is applied, the stage 2 is moved away from the battery cell along the third direction c, and the battery cell is only attracted by the suction plate 4, so as to provide operating space for the second roller 12 to roll the wrapping film onto the back of the battery cell.
[0062] In this embodiment, preferably, as follows: Figure 1 and Figure 2As shown, the suction plate 4 assembly also includes a fourth driving member 6. The suction plate 4 is mounted on the driving end of the fourth driving member 6 via the third driving member 5. The fourth driving member 6 can drive the suction plate 4 to move along the first direction a, thereby adjusting the position of the suction plate 4 along the first direction a so that the suction plate 4 can be accurately adsorbed onto the battery cell. At the same time, the suction plate 4 can also be used to drive the battery cell to adjust its position along the first direction a, so as to ensure that when the first roller 11 rolls over the side seal, the first roller 11 rolls over the planar area of the side seal.
[0063] In one embodiment of the application, preferably, as shown below,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, the rolling assembly 1 is provided in two sets. The two sets of rolling assemblies 1 are arranged at intervals relative to each other along the second direction b. The suction cup assembly and the lifting assembly are located between the two sets of rolling assemblies 1. The suction cup assembly and the lifting assembly can drive the battery cell through the two sets of rolling assemblies 1 so that the two sets of rolling assemblies 1 can simultaneously apply the side sealing film to both sides of the battery cell.
